如果使用了SQLITE_DEFAULT_FOREIGN_KEYS编译本机库,则无需启用外键,就像在 e_sqlite3 中一样。 C# publicbool? ForeignKeys {get;set; } 属性值 Nullable<Boolean> 一个指示是否启用外键约束的值。 适用于 产品版本 Microsoft.Data.SQLite3.0, 3.1, 5.0, 6.0, 7.0, 8.0, 9.0 反馈 此页面是否有帮助? 是否...
在golang中,sqlite3是一个轻量级的嵌入式数据库引擎,它提供了一个自包含、零配置的、事务性的SQL数据库引擎。SQLite是一个开源项目,被广泛应用于移动设备和嵌入式系统中。 foreign_keys是SQLite中的一个杂注(pragma),用于控制外键约束的行为。在SQLite中,默认情况下,外键约束是禁用的,即使在创建表时定义了外...
若將SQLITE_DEFAULT_FOREIGN_KEYS 用來編譯原生 SQLite 程式庫 (例如在 e_sqlite3 中),則無須啟用外部索引鍵。遞迴觸發程序為一個值,用來指出是否要啟用遞迴觸發。注意 3.0 版本已新增 Recursive Triggers 關鍵字。展開資料表 值Description True 在開啟連線後立刻傳送 PRAGMA recursive_triggers。 False 不會傳送...
删除:PRAGMA foreign_keys=ON; Delete From A Where ID= 4;(删除A表中ID=4的行,表B中A_ID=4的所有行同时删除,需要在执行的sql语句中加上PRAGMA foreign_keys=ON;,因为sqlite3默认为关闭外键限制的) 查询语句理解: int sqlite3_get_table( sqlite3 *db, /* An open database */ const char *zSql,...
导入Sqlite.swift 使用, 先使用 Table 创建表 ,Expression 创建字段, 增删改查都使用 optionUserModel 操作 letOptionUserModel=Table("user")//user表名称,可同model名letname=Expression<String>("name") let sex = Expression<String>("sex") let user_id = Expression<Int>("user_id") ...
PRAGMA foreign_keys = true;默认情况下,由于历史原因,SQLite不强制执行外键,需要手动启用它们。PRAGMA busy_timeout = 5000;正如之前看到的,设置一个更大的busy_timeout有助于防止SQLITE_BUSY错误。对于面向用户的应用程序(例如API),建议使用5000(5秒);后端应用程序(例如队列或应用模块间调用的API),可...
外键约束 foreign key 外键约束的要求: 父表和字表必须使用相同的存储引擎,禁止使用临时表; 数据库...
"+STU_CLS_ID_COL+" integer not null"+"foreign key(cls_id) reference classes(cls_id));";//...@OverridepublicvoidonCreate(SQLiteDatabasedb){//因为Students表中使用了外键,所以必须先声明db.execSQL("PRAGMA foreign_keys = ON");db.execSQL(CREATE_CLASSES_TABLE);db.execSQL(CREATE_STUDENT_...
PRAGMA foreign_keys=OFF; BEGIN TRANSACTION; CREATE TABLE long(h,m); INSERT INTO "long" VALUES('hhhhhh',2); INSERT INTO "long" VALUES('hello',2); INSERT INTO "long" VALUES('mall',5); INSERT INTO "long" VALUES('suinvzi',8); ...
PRAGMA foreign_keys=OFF; BEGINTRANSACTION; CREATETABLEwork(baodanhao textuniqueprimarykey, chudanriqi text,qudao text,lianxiren text,xiaoshou text,beibaorenxingming text,chufar iqi text,baoxianpinpai text,baoxianjihua text,baoxianjinereal,yongjinbilvreal,jingbaofeireal,huankuanfangshi text,haikuanjin...